    Tasting notes

    This collection makes a perfect treat or yuletide gift for the discerning wine drinker, showcasing fine examples of some of our favourite Christmas wines from well-known wine regions across the world.

    James Bryant Hill Central Coast Zinfandel 2019-  Aromas of blackberries, cassis, strawberry jam and toasty oak leap from the glass of this easy-drinking Californian red Zinfandel, followed by a lingering black fruit finish and a hint of mocha. Perfect for an evening by the fire.

    Valdubon Crianza 2018, Ribera del Duero- From vines that are over 30 years old the grapes that go into this beautifully-made Crianza create elegant flavours of fresh red fruit, mingled with notes of coconut, vanilla, cocoa, spice and thyme. Perfect to have stashed away for an intimate dinner with friends.

     

    Long Valley Ranch Monterey Cabernet Sauvignon 2019- This full-bodied Cabernet Sauvignon has aromas of black fruit with toasty notes. The palate has an abundance of sweet, rich dark fruit character, overlaid by vanilla spiced oak and a satisfying tannic grip.

    Black Cottage Marlborough Pinot Noir 2020- Perfectly paired with rich foods, this wine is dark and brooding with aromas of forest floor, black cherry and chocolate-coated coffee bean. The palate has spicy, peppery notes with thyme, violets and a texture typical to Marlborough's Southern Valleys.

    James Bryant Hill Central Coast Chardonnay 2019- A standout dry Californian Chardonnay with a palate of yellow apple, pear and citrus blossom and a touch of vanilla and butterscotch. Pair with roast chicken or creamy vegetarian risotto.

    Clouston & Co Marlborough Sauvignon Blanc 2021- Clouston & Co’s 100 year legacy shows with this delightful gem. It has billowing aromas of fresh herbs, summer flowers, honeydew melon, blackcurrant, kiwi and passionfruit. The zesty, tropical palate has a lovely texture and lively finish.

    Louis Robin Chablis 2021- Very dry, lively, even acidic, and with an admirable finesse, Chablis has a recognisable personality. This fresh and mineral Chablis evokes flint, green apple, lemon and grapefruit. This wine leaves a taste of gunflint or mushroom on the palate

    Schloss Johannisberg Gelblack Riesling Trocken Rheingau 2020- Hailing from one of the most historic German wine making estates, this 93 point-winning dry Riesling combines great minerality with lots of fresh lime, peach and subtle tropical fruit.

    Black Cottage Pinot Noir Rosé 2020-  Recommended by James Davis, this elegant and eminently drinkable rosé is a sophisticated addition to the Christmas season. On the nose, it delivers notes of cranberry, melon and sea breeze aromas with undertones of raspberries and subtle liquorice, mirrored on the palate. Ideal as an aperitif.

    Whispering Angel Cotes de Provence Rosé 2022-This iconic Provençal pink offers creamy flavours of peach and raspberries with refreshing citrus undertones and a smooth, dry finish. We recommend pairing this benchmark rosé with oily fish, and dishes with peppers or garlic.

    Gratien & Meyer Cremant de Loire Brut NV- This elegant and fruity fizz from Loire is bound to be a new favourite. The aroma is perfumed and pronounced, with citrus, honey and acacia notes.. Perfect for popping to start the new year.

    Champagne Leon Launois Brut NV- This multiple award-winning Champagne definitely deserves a seat at the table this year. A Lovely, fruity champagne that is ideal as an aperitif or with starters such as crisps, seafood or olives. Citrus and brioche notes, light and easy going and effortlessly drinkable.
